Technical Considerations for Stitching

While the visual appeal is strong, the technical execution is where many designs fail. As an experienced designer, I advise caution and preparation when working with multi-color, detailed designs like this. Here are the practical aspects you need to consider before hitting "start" on your machine.

Fabric and Stabilizer Choice
The success of any applique design or detailed fill depends heavily on your stabilizer. For stretchy fabrics like sweatshirt fleece or jersey, a cut-away stabilizer is non-negotiable to prevent puckering. For woven fabrics like canvas totes or aprons, a tear-away might suffice, but given the likely density of the crayon fills, I would recommend a medium-weight cut-away for longevity. Always test on scrap fabric first. This allows you to check thread tension and ensure the stitch density does not cause the fabric to warp.

Thread Colors and Contrast
The design features Yellow, Pink, and Blue crayons. These are bright, saturated colors. When stitching on dark fabrics, you may need to adjust your underlay or use a white base thread to make the colors pop. Conversely, on light fabrics, ensure your thread colors have enough contrast against the background. If you are using variegated threads, be careful; they can sometimes muddy the distinct labels on the crayons. Solid, high-quality rayon or polyester threads will give you the best satin stitch definition.

Hoop Size and Placement
Before purchasing, you must confirm the hoop size requirements listed on the Creative Fabrica product page. While the description mentions playful decorative accents, it does not specify exact dimensions. If the design is large, it may not fit on smaller caps or narrow tote straps. If you plan to use this on curved surfaces like baseball caps, ensure you have the appropriate cap frame and that the design width does not exceed the usable area of the cap front. Tiny lettering can be tricky on textured fabrics, so inspect the small details after a test stitch to ensure readability.
